We are currently seeking an experienced professional to join our team in the role of Assistant Vice President, Model Risk Governance and Stewardship Principal responsibilities Supporting the setting of the firm s model risk policies and procedures. Supporting reviews to ensure policy is implemented effectively across businesses and functions. Producing and providing Model Risk Reporting on a regular basis. Supporting the development of appropriate training materials. Suggest enhancements to systems, tooling and/or working practices to improve efficiency. Prepare the related model risk governance reporting. Support the development of appropriate Model Risk Governance procedures, tools and management information. Work with colleagues in 1LOD(Line of Defense), 2LOD and 3LOD to deliver the broader set of Global Model Risk Governance deliverables. Contribute to management, regulatory, and external confidence in all models used across the group. Support the management of model risk across a large complex banking group. Support model risk whilst significant transformational activity is being implemented, both regionally and globally. Operate within a changing and rapidly developing regulatory environment. Continually support HSBCs approach to conduct and cultivate a positive risk aware culture, which is designed to ensure we deliver fair outcomes for our customers and do not disrupt the orderly and transparent operation of financial markets. Requirements Experience of model risk management, governance and/or model development / validation. Understanding of Risk Management Framework, Risk Controls is mandatory Experience of local regulators and regulations would be an advantage. Some knowledge and expertise of local market and HSBC s different business lines is preferable. 5-10 years of professional experience in risk management would be preferable. Experience to be able to identify and implement process improvements. Ability to develop strong networks with key stakeholders at all points in a matrix structure, creating an ability to execute task at hand with minimum conflict. Providing expert advice, robust challenge and managing risk and controls Strong written and oral communication skills. Attention to detail. Team-oriented mentality combined with ability to complete tasks independently to a high-quality standard.
